Melbourne, Cottage on Blackwell Lane
Melbourne is a former market town about 8 miles south of Derby, 8 miles north of Swadlincote and 2 miles from the River Trent. In 1837 a then tiny settlement in Australia was named after William Lamb, 2nd Viscount Melbourne, Queen Victoria's first Prime Minister, and thus indirectly takes its name from the Derbyshire village.
